This is the sixth of 15 short atlases reimagines the classic 5 volume Atlas of Human Central Nervous System Development. A handy paperback edition focuses on the earliest part of the first trimester of human brain development. Serial sections from specimens between 40mm and 42mm are illustrated and annotated in great detail, together with 3D reconstructions. An introduction and glossary summarize these earliest stages of human Central Nervous System development.
Key Features
1) Classic anatomical atlases
2) Detailed labeling of the earliest phases of prenatal neurological development
3) Appeals to neuroanatomists, developmental biologists and clinical practitioners.
4) Persistent relevance - brain development is not going to change.
